Output b3fecfa8be25e136ac0e391b96e82ffe25520dc3dc1759f7ec64e9abab341d60:2

value
21328606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b01335671c0f322661a17cc7d5b8ffef8b22f36d OP_EQUALVERIFY OP_CHECKSIG
address
1H3zwQAaHFNf6wZjEbEaMjpLYosFCkjYYu
transaction
b3fecfa8be25e136ac0e391b96e82ffe25520dc3dc1759f7ec64e9abab341d60
confirmations
526689
spent
true